Why couples

Why couples book together.

Couples massage is rarely about acute body issues; it's about shared time, a milestone marked, a reconnection after a busy stretch, a gift that turns into an experience. The bodywork itself still matters, but the framing differs from a single remedial booking. Couples massage on the Sunshine Coast often combines with a day out, a weekend away, or a particular occasion that the session anchors.

Worth being clear upfront: this is a single-therapist practice. Couples sessions here run sequentially, one partner then the other in the same booking window, rather than two side-by-side simultaneous massages. For two-therapist simultaneous couples massage, larger day spas are the right option. For personalised one-on-one work for each partner with shared time around it, this practice fits well. Format

How couples sessions work.

The standard format runs sequentially in the same booking window: one partner has their session while the other waits comfortably (in clinic) or relaxes in another room (at home), then they switch. Two 60-minute sessions take around two and a half hours including the brief handover; two 75-minute sessions take three. Both partners get the same level of focused attention.

Is this a side-by-side simultaneous couples massage?

Honestly, no. This is a single-therapist practice, so couples massage here means sequential sessions, one after the other in the same booking window, not two side-by-side massages at once. The advantage: both partners get the same focused, personalised attention. The disadvantage: you don't share the room during the session. For two-therapist simultaneous couples massage, day spas with multiple practitioners are the right option.
